Date: February 11, 2018
Venue: Perth Arena
City: Perth, Australia
Time: 10pm ET/7pm PT
Viewing: PPV

MAIN CARD (PPV)

Middleweight Interim Championship bout: Yoel Romero vs. Luke Rockhold
Heavyweight bout: Mark Hunt vs. Curtis Blaydes
Heavyweight bout: Tai Tuivasa vs. Cyril Asker
Welterweight bout: Jake Matthews vs. Li Jingliang
Light Heavyweight bout: Tyson Pedro vs. Saparbek Safarov

PRELIMINARY CARD (FS1, TSN 2)

Lightweight bout: Damien Brown vs. Dong Hyun Kim
Middleweight bout: Rob Wilkinson vs. Israel Adesanya
Featherweight bout: Jeremy Kennedy vs. Alexander Volkanovski
Flyweight bout: Jussier Formiga vs. Ben Nguyen

PRELIMINARY CARD (UFC Fight Pass)

Lightweight bout: Ross Pearson vs. Mizuto Hirota
Bantamweight bout: Teruto Ishihara vs. José Alberto Quiñónez
Welterweight bout: Luke Jumeau vs. Daichi Abe​
